Essentials for Spring Cleanup

A comprehensive spring cleanup is crucial for refreshing outdoor spaces and maintaining their beauty throughout the year. This process typically begins with the removal of debris, such as leaves, twigs, and dead plants, which can house pests and diseases. Next, pruning trees and shrubs stimulates healthy growth and improves aesthetics. Lawn care is also critical; raking, aerating, and overseeding foster a lush, green lawn. Additionally, assessing and cleaning garden beds allows for the proper placement of new seasonal plants. Mulching not only boosts soil health but also suppresses weeds. Finally, checking irrigation systems guarantees efficient watering. By addressing these spring cleanup essentials, homeowners can create a vibrant outdoor environment that flourishes in the warmer months ahead.

Winter Preparation Strategies

As the mercury drops and early winter signals arrive, thorough preparation becomes critical for preserving landscape health and aesthetics throughout the colder months. Experienced landscape care specialists advise several strategies to guarantee ideal care. Initially, trimming trees and shrubs prevents damage from substantial snow and ice accumulation. Moreover, laying down mulch protects the ground, safeguarding roots against frost. Winterizing irrigation systems is essential to avoid pipe damage, while appropriate tool storage increases longevity. Lastly, planting winter-hardy species can add visual interest and maintain ecological diversity. By utilizing these seasonal preparation methods, homeowners can safeguard their landscapes, guaranteeing they return lush and thriving as warmer temperatures return.

Sustainable Outdoor Space Techniques

Though many typical landscaping practices can harm the environment, eco-friendly landscaping techniques offer a practical alternative that promotes both beauty and sustainability. These methods focus on the use of organic materials and decrease chemical inputs, producing healthier soil and ecosystems. Practices such as mulching, composting, and rainwater harvesting not only decrease waste but also save resources. Moreover, eco-friendly techniques often involve xeriscaping, which utilizes drought-resistant plants to decrease water usage. Adopting integrated pest management (IPM) strategies further enhances environmental health by emphasizing natural pest control methods. By implementing these techniques, professional landscape maintenance services can establish vibrant, sustainable outdoor spaces that enhance both aesthetics and ecological balance, supporting a greener future.

Indigenous Plant Implementation

How does incorporating native plants change landscape maintenance strategies? Incorporating native plants into landscape design can substantially increase sustainability and ecological health. These plants are naturally suited to local climates, requiring reduced water, fertilizers, and pesticides versus non-native species. This not only reduces maintenance costs but also decreases environmental impact.

Additionally, native plants help maintain local wildlife, including pollinators, birds, and beneficial insects, fostering biodiversity. Their resilience also signifies they are less vulnerable to pests and diseases, further minimizing the need for chemical interventions.
